Transaction 138a57e931588314733ca367684833f14d8eda93becde226c3c70877244e0a8c
1 Input
1 Output
-
138a57e931588314733ca367684833f14d8eda93becde226c3c70877244e0a8c:0
- value
- 67000
- script pubkey
- OP_0 OP_PUSHBYTES_20 d253c2f6b153bc121f9b779f1cb01f56bda6bf2f
- address
- bc1q6ffu9a432w7py8umw703evql2676d0e0y9a04c